当前位置:首页 > 行业动态 > 正文

探索MySQL数据库,哪些书籍值得推荐?

《高性能MySQL》是一本广受推崇的MySQL数据库好书,深入讲解了如何优化和提升MySQL性能。书中结合实例分析,覆盖了索引设计、查询优化、服务器参数调整等关键领域,适合数据库管理员和开发人员阅读。

关于mysql数据库好书的详细介绍及推荐,具体分析如下:

1、《SQL学习指南》

内容:本书介绍了SQL语言的基础知识以及高级特性,包括SQL基本查询、过滤、多数据表查询、集合、数据操作、分组和聚合、子查询、连接、条件逻辑、事务、索引和约束、视图等内容。

特点循序渐进,每章主题相对独立,提供丰富示例和精选练习,适合不同层次的读者有效学习和快速掌握SQL语言。

2、《MySQL是怎样使用的》

内容:本书从零基础用户的角度出发,详细介绍了如何使用MySQL,内容包括MySQL的安装、服务器程序和客户端程序的使用、数据类型、数据库和表的基本操作等入门知识,以及视图、存储程序、备份与恢复、用户与权限管理等高级概念。

特点深入浅出,通俗易懂,契合MySQL初学人员的学习曲线,帮助他们迅速入门MySQL。

3、《MySQL是怎样运行的》

内容:本书采用诙谐幽默的表达方式,对MySQL的底层运行原理进行了介绍,内容涵盖了MySQL的核心概念,如记录、页面、索引、表空间的结构和用法,以及单表查询、连接查询的执行原理,事务和锁的实现等。

特点:适合技术人员、DBA或刚投身于数据库行业的“萌新”人员彻底了解MySQL运行原理的优秀图书。

4、《深入浅出MySQL》

内容:本书基于网易公司多位资深数据库专家的经验归纳和使用心得,分为“基础篇”、“开发篇”、“优化篇”、“管理维护篇”和“架构篇”五个部分,共32章,涵盖了MySQL的安装与配置、SQL基础、数据类型、运算符、常用函数、表类型(存储引擎)的选择、索引的设计和使用、事务控制和锁定语句等内容。

特点实用,覆盖广泛,讲解由浅入深,提供大量一线工作实例,适合数据库管理人员、开发人员、系统维护人员、初学者及其他数据库从业人员阅读。

5、《高性能MySQL》

内容:本书是MySQL领域的经典之作,更新了大量内容,涵盖了最新MySQL版本的新特性,以及固态盘、高可扩展性设计和云计算环境下的数据库相关内容,原有的基准测试和性能优化部分也做了大量的扩展和补充。

特点:适合数据库管理员(DBA)阅读,也适合开发人员参考学习,不管是数据库新手还是专家,都能从本书有所收获。

6、《MySQL技术内幕》

内容:本书由国内资深MySQL专家执笔,深入解析了InnoDB存储引擎的体系结构、实现原理、工作机制,并给出了大量最佳实践,能帮助读者系统而深入地掌握InnoDB,并提供设计管理高性能、高可用的数据库系统的指导。

特点:适合所有希望构建和管理高性能、高可用性的MySQL数据库系统的开发者和DBA阅读。

7、《数据库索引设计与优化》

内容:本书提供了一种简单、高效、通用的关系型数据库索引设计方法,通过系统的讲解及大量的案例清晰地阐释了关系型数据库的访问路径选择原理,以及表和索引的扫描方式,详尽地讲解了如何快速地估算SQL运行的CPU时间及执行时间。

特点:帮助读者从原理上理解SQL、表及索引结构、访问方式等对关系型数据库造成的影响,并能够运用量化的方法进行判断和优化。

书籍均为MySQL数据库领域内的权威著作,涵盖了从基础入门到高级应用、性能优化、内部原理等多个方面,适合不同层次的读者根据自己的需求和水平选择阅读。

0